Women's Basketball: Panthers fall to Warriors to open KCAC play

STERLING, Kan. – The York University women's basketball team lost an 89-45 game at Sterling Saturday afternoon in the KCAC opener.

The Panthers are now 4-3 on the season, including 0-1 in KCAC action.

Head coach Corinna Minjarez's team was led by Lawson Hiltl and Amaya Payne as each poured in eight points. Valeria Costilla, Alliyana Page and Monique Contreras netted six points apiece. Zoe Brown added five points while Yareli Gomez and Alesia Rand chipped in four and two points, respectively.

Page led the way with five boards while Costilla, Payne and Rand snagged four rebounds each.

Olivia Adams, Contreras and Costilla had two assists each.

Defensively, Gomez and Contreras had a block each while Gomez snagged a team-best two steals.  

The visitors never led, but the squad outscored the home team 9-8 in the final 10 minutes of action. In the fourth, Costilla got things going with a jumper. Page hit two charity tosses before Contreras took a pass from Costilla for a lay-up. After a shot from Sterling, Contreras hit a free throw. The home team scored six straight before Brown closed the scoring with a lay-up.

For the game, York hit 18-of-60 from the floor and made four three-point buckets. The team canned 83.3 percent of its foul shots. The Panthers dished out 10 assists and recorded seven steals. York scored 24 points in the paint and had eight points off miscues.
